Title: Pilot reported that due to a Presidential TFR and fatigue; pilot landed on a lake that was not approved for seaplane operations.

Narrative: After 2 days of long cross country flying; I was on the last day along the Hudson river through the NY special flight rules with Presidential TFR in progress. There was a higher stress/workload due to airspace and active TFR navigation. After flying north the corridor then up near military academy; turned eastward towards destination. Using map I thought I was going to do a water landing at what appeared to be one lake; but after landing decided our navigation was incorrect. I did an immediate takeoff and left the lake. However the lake; not being published on FAA charts; I later found out seaplane ops were prohibited. There was not any safety issue I could see that would consider this unsafe; and I kept visual with boat traffic and people; but was unaware the lake wasn't seaplane approved. There should be a better database of lakes; rivers; waterways that are legal/safe to land that is inclusive.
